Which water filter and water transport system is ideal for your tour?
Not every water filter is equally suitable for every situation. Depending on the area of application, group size and personal preferences, there are different types of filters and water transport systems that differ in their functionality and filter performance.
1. Water filters: What types are there and how do they work?
Pump filter – ideal for groups and longer tours
Pump filters are one of the most reliable water filter systems for outdoor adventures. They work with a mechanical pump that allows you to pump water from rivers, lakes or puddles into your water bottle or water bag. High-quality models, such as the Katadyn Hiker Pro , are equipped with powerful filters that remove 99.9% of bacteria, protozoa and sediment . They are perfect for groups because they can filter larger volumes of water in a short period of time.
Gravity filter – efficient and comfortable in base camp
If you're spending a long time in one place, such as camping or at a base camp, gravity filters are a convenient solution. You simply hang a water bag of unfiltered water and let gravity do the work. Systems like the Platypus GravityWorks or the Katadyn BeFree Gravity can purify several liters of water at a time without you having to pump.
Bottle Filter – Ultralight and perfect for solo adventures
For minimalists and ultralight hikers, bottle filters are the ideal choice. These systems, like the Katadyn BeFree , allow you to drink directly from natural water sources. The filter is integrated directly into the water bottle and removes bacteria and protozoa as soon as you drink. Bottle filters are light, compact and particularly practical for day hikes or quick tours with little luggage .
Ceramic filter – Robust and durable solution
Ceramic filters are particularly durable and have the advantage that they can be easily cleaned. They are suitable for tours in extreme conditions where you need long-term water treatment . Their disadvantage, however, is the higher weight and lower flow rate compared to other filter systems.
2. Water transport: How can you carry water efficiently on the go?
Hydration Bladders – Practical for Hikers and Bikers
If you move around a lot, you should use a hydration bladder with a tube system . These can be integrated into the backpack and allow you to drink a constant amount of liquid without having to stop. This is a big advantage, especially on long hikes or bikepacking tours . Manufacturers like Platypus offer different sizes, so you can choose the right volume for your tour.
Foldable water bags – flexible and space-saving
If you need to carry several liters of water for your camp, foldable water bags are a clever solution. They are lightweight, fold up small and only take up space when they are full. They are particularly ideal for expeditions or group trips .
Water canisters – large quantities for base camp
For longer stays in one place or for family and group camping , foldable water canisters with an outlet valve are particularly practical. They allow the water to be easily removed and can be stored in a space-saving manner after use.
